【问题标题】:Implement Order Screen实施订单屏幕
【发布时间】:2015-01-12 23:23:52
【问题描述】:

这不是一个纯粹的编程问题;相反,它与实现细节有关。需要实现一个订单处理屏幕,在该屏幕中,客户发出由多个项目组成的订单。这是一个两步操作,用户必须输入客户的姓名(或从列表中选择一个名称)并输入订单详细信息(数据库术语中的详细信息块)并同样输入项目或从列表中选择它们列表。如何在 Android 设备上最好地执行此交易?

(请注意,我问的不是数据库操作的编程,而是布局上需要哪些对象才能实现这样的事务。)

【问题讨论】:

    标签: android


    【解决方案1】:

    关于实现(无代码),我试图给出最简单但最有效的方法。

    1. 给用户一个选择(可能是按钮)来输入客户名称或从列表中选择。

    2. 如果选项是输入名称,TextViewsButtons 可以解决问题。

    3. 要从列表中选择,请尝试ListView

    4. 点击任何ListView 条款,ActivityTextViewsButtons 以获取订单详细信息。

    5. 要选择项目,请在每个项目名称旁边提供Dialog Windowcheck boxes

    希望这会有所帮助。如果您需要有关代码的任何帮助,请回复我。

    【讨论】:

    • 如果我要对客户姓名使用列表视图——有没有办法结合文本框功能来限制姓名?这样,如果用户键入“a”,列表就会缩小到以字母“a”开头的条目,依此类推......
    • 这个也是可以的,可以安静方便。按照链接 1.stackoverflow.com/questions/2374177/… 2.androidpeople.com/android-listview-searchbox-sort-items 此外,如果您想在应用程序中合并数据库使用,您的应用程序将更像是 Android 手机中的联系人应用程序,您可以通过数据库对数据执行 CRUD 操作, 那是。您还可以查看此示例以了解如何使您的应用正常运行 3. cs.trincoll.edu/hfoss/wiki/…
    • 谢谢。还有一件事,如果要订购的商品如您所描述的那样在对话框窗口中显示给用户,是否可以输入订购的每件商品的数量?另外,关闭对话窗口后,主屏幕(包含客户姓名)将如何显示订购的商品?
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-12-13
    • 1970-01-01
    • 2015-09-13
    相关资源
    最近更新 更多